当前位置:当前位置: 首页 >
既然操作系统层已经提供了page cache的功能,为什么还要在应用层加缓存?
人气:发表时间:2025-06-24 18:15:16
page cache主要是面对磁盘I/O这块,尤其在顺序I/O场景,很好利用到局部性原理(包括空间和时间两个维度),能极高I/O读写效率。
应该说innodb的b+树(读写均衡或读密集型),lsm树(高并发写密集型),kafka顺序日志(高吞吐量消息)都是很好利用这一点。
至于应用层的缓存,从局部性原理来说,都是一样的。
就是把最近时间和范围内,经常用到的数据缓存起来,减少系统的压力。
不同之处在于,应用层缓存的是业务数据,这个数据可…。
同类文章排行
- 吵架后,老公快一个星期不联系,是要离婚的节奏吗?
- ***拍大尺度片子时摄影师不会看光吗?
- 腰椎间盘突出导致腿麻脚麻怎么办?
- Windows 下有什么用过之后就离不开的冷门软件?
- 有哪些是你用上了mac才知道的事?
- 20届设计系,我的设计水平很差吗,找不到合适的工作?
- Golang 中为什么没有注解?
- 爸爸带大的孩子是什么样子?
- 钱学森放在现在是什么水准?
- 长期使用的大佬来说说,MacOS 真的比 Windows 稳定吗?
最新资讯文章
- 哪些音频剪辑工具很好用?
- AI 生成时代,现有编程语言还够用吗?
- 大家的NAS都是24小时不关机吗?
- 目前最流行的 rust web 框架是什么?
- NAS的盘是否需要一次性买齐?
- 目前中国程序员和美国程序员的差距在哪里?
- 普通人自学编程能赶上大学计算机编程专业的水平吗?
- Windows有哪些神级软件?
- 吴柳芳的真实水平如何?
- 现在个人博客不能备案了吗?
- 新买了一台nas,第一个月下载20t+,上传5+,不会被网警盯上吧?
- 字节大量使用新语言,包括go,rust等,为什么阿里一直都抱着j***a不松手?
- 为什么腰突不受到医学界的重视?
- 腰陆陆续续疼了一年多了,这个是腰突吗?
- 怎么看待B站舞蹈区和某些风格比较暴露的up?
- LCD党真的只是少部分人吗?
- 有哪些看似聪明,实则很傻的行为?
- 程序员每天会阅读哪些技术网站来提升自己?
- 郭靖傻乎乎的,也不帅,为啥黄蓉这种优质女朋友会那么喜欢他?
- tkinter可以做出多复杂的界面?